如何强制您的.gitlab-ci.yml文件以root用户身份运行脚本?

时间:2018-11-29 20:43:38

标签: python gitlab yaml gitlab-ci gitlab-ci-runner

我目前有一个.gitlab-ci.yml文件,该文件应该运行一组特定的功能。尽管它过去可以正常运行,但现在(两个月后)它似乎不再默认在根目录上运行。也就是说,现在,当我按下命令apt-get update时,它将返回E: List directory /var/lib/apt/lists/partial is missing. - Acquire (30: Read-only file system)。如何修改YAML文件,使其可以在root上运行?我当前的文件如下:

before_script:
    - apt-get update -y
    - apt-get install git -y
    - apt-get install python -y
    - apt-get install python-pip -y

main:
    script:
        - echo 'Done...'

由于文件在apt-get update -y处中断,如何修改我的JAML文件以便在根目录上运行它?

0 个答案:

没有答案